Kish, Hunt Earn NFCA All-Region Honors

The impactful season had by the Hillsdale College softball team has resulted in some high-level honors for two of its finest players.

Junior outfielder Katie Kish was named First-Team All-Region by the National Fastpitch Coaches Association, marking the second consecutive year a Charger outfielder has been named All-Region. Freshman pitcher Erin Hunt earned Second-Team All-Region honors.

Kish is now eligible for All-American honors through the NFCA program. She was one of three outfielders in the Midwest Region to make the first team.

Entering the NCAA Tournament, Kish is ranked sixth in the NCAA in batting average, sporting an impressive .496 mark through 38 games this season. A lefthanded hitter with speed and power, Kish has had her best season. She has 62 total hits and batted .500 during the G-MAC Tournament, won by the Chargers last week. One year ago, Bekah Kastning was also a First-Team All-Region selection from Hillsdale.

Hunt is 19-6 on the season with a 1.61 earned run average. She's won eight straight decisions and rolled through the conference tournament, going 4-0 with a 0.26 earned run average and 34 strikeouts versus just three walks.
